Output 1466284888fdbf90e10a8e0328cd1c80efc6c26fef082c98c289ebffcb45bc24:3

value
19970000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2706992f03161d406e4558f43a38fd5f792e0451 OP_EQUALVERIFY OP_CHECKSIG
address
14ZMFwn2vhgEqi7P9S5bmSsuADkWNbnQMm
transaction
1466284888fdbf90e10a8e0328cd1c80efc6c26fef082c98c289ebffcb45bc24
spent
true